About

Daryl Cole is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Surgery and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Daryl Cole has authored 3 papers receiving a total of 238 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 1 paper in Molecular Biology, 1 paper in Surgery and 1 paper in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Daryl Cole’s work include R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(1 paper), Wound Healing and Treatments (1 paper) and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(1 paper). Daryl Cole is often cited by papers focused on R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(1 paper), Wound Healing and Treatments (1 paper) and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(1 paper). Daryl Cole coll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om. Daryl Cole's co-authors include Irene Cantón, Sheila MacNeil, John W. Haycock, Anthony J. Ryan, Christine Freeman, Keith A. Blackwood, Ian M. Brook, Stephen Rimmer, E. Helen Kemp and P. F. Watson and has published in prestigious journals such as Biomaterials, Cancer Research and Biotechnology and Bioengineering.
